Salve a tutti.
Sto cercando di costruire un piccolo database per registrare, ed eventualmente, calcolare l'incasso di importi in denaro.
Lo schema che ho pensato è il seguente:
ho due tabelle, Dati generali e Dettaglio collegate tra loro nel seguente modo: ad ogni record/riga di Dati generali deve corrispondere una o più righe/record della tabella Dettaglio.
Nella tabella Dati Generali sono inseriti data di versamento, importo versato, nome della persona etc.
Nella tabella Dettaglio, come appunto suggerisce il nome, c'è in dettaglio relativo al versamento effettuato. Cioè quali sono le voci che hanno determinato l'importo totale indicato nella tabella Dati Generali al campo Importo versato con i rispettivi importi parziali.
Ho preparato un formulario dove posso inserire i dati (è solo una bozza, devo poi aggiungere altre cose) e mi compaiono le due tabelle sopra indicate.
Ora il mio problema è questo:
quando seleziono un record della tabella Dati Generali, ovviamente, visualizzo il corrispondente dettaglio della tabella Dettaglio.
Il mio problema, che non so come risolvere è quello che vorrei che mi comparisse, nel formulario, la somma degli importi parziali della tabella Dettaglio relativa al record della tabella Dati Generali.
In questo modo potrei confrontare se l'importo versato corrisponde alla somma degli importi parziali così poi da calcolare se c'è resto da dare etc etc.
L'unica cosa che sono riuscito a fare è la query della somma della tabella Dettaglio, solo che mi da la somma totale di tutti i record contenuti.
Allago il database che ho costruito.
Grazie a chiunque mi possa dare indicazioni in merito
Database con calcolo
Database con calcolo
- Allegati
-
- Prova incasso quote condominiali.odb
- Modificato
- (16.37 KiB) Scaricato 158 volte
LibreOffice 7.4 Kubuntu 22.04 LTS
Re: Database con calcolo
Ciao, ho scritto la query 'R_Somma' che calcola la somma in relazione all' 'ID_principale' della tabella 'Dati generali' e poi aggiunto un subform contenente la stessa.
Mi pare funzioni.
Mi pare funzioni.
- Allegati
-
- Prova_incasso_quote_condominiali_2.odb
- (26.02 KiB) Scaricato 205 volte
charlie
macOS 15.5 Sequoia: Open Office 4.1.15 - LibreOffice 7.5.7.2
http://www.charlieopenoffice.altervista.org
macOS 15.5 Sequoia: Open Office 4.1.15 - LibreOffice 7.5.7.2
http://www.charlieopenoffice.altervista.org
Re: Database con calcolo
Come sempre devo ringraziarti 
nel formulario compilazione1 non si apre.
Comunque sono riuscito a mettere la tabella R_Somma nel mio formulario Compilazione in modo da avere tutto sotto controllo
Allego la nuova versione del file

nel formulario compilazione1 non si apre.
Comunque sono riuscito a mettere la tabella R_Somma nel mio formulario Compilazione in modo da avere tutto sotto controllo
Allego la nuova versione del file
- Allegati
-
- Prova incasso quote condominiali vers_3.odb
- (27.67 KiB) Scaricato 190 volte
LibreOffice 7.4 Kubuntu 22.04 LTS